유한요소 해석을 이용한 합금화 용융아연도금강판의 도금층 파우더링에 관한 연구
김동욱(D.W. Kim),장윤찬(Y.C. Jang),이영석(Y. S. Lee),김성일(S.I. Kim) 대한기계학회 2007 대한기계학회 춘추학술대회 Vol.2007 No.10
Demand for hot-dip galvannealed steel has been increased due to it high corrosion resistance, paintability, and formability in automotive industry. Coating of Hot-dip galvannealed steel consists of various Fe-Zn intermetallic compounds. Since the coating is hard and therefore it is very brittle, the surface of steel sheet is easy to be ruptured during second manufacturing processing. This is called as powdering. Hence, various research have been carried out to prohibit powdering for improving the quality of GA steel during second manufacturing processing. This paper performed finite element analysis to evaluate local powdering and compared FEA results with V-bending test. The effects of punch radius and coating strength on the powdering was examined.
